RiskFactors
Factorsthatincreaseapatient’sriskofanADRincludesizeandstructureofdrug,routeofexposure
(cutaneousmostimmunogenic),dose,duration,frequency,gender(women>men),geneticfactors(HLA
type,historyofatopy),priordrugreaction,coexistingmedicalillnesses,andconcurrentmedicaltherapy.
DIAGNOSIS
ClinicalPresentation
A history is essential for making the diagnosis of an allergic drug reaction. Questions should be
directedatestablishingthefollowinginformation:signandsymptoms,timingofthereaction,purpose
of the drug, other medications the patient is receiving, prior exposure to drug or related drug, and
historyofotherallergicdrugreactions.
Urticaria, angioedema, wheezing, and anaphylaxis are all characteristics of IgE-mediated (type 1)
reactions.
Symptomsdonottypicallyoccuronthefirstexposuretothemedicationunlessthepatienthasbeen
exposedtoa structurallyrelated medication. Onreexposure, however, symptoms tendto manifest
acutely(often<1hour).
IgE-mediatedreactionstendtoworsenwithrepeatedexposuretotheoffendingmedication.
Non–IgE-mediatedreactions(anaphylactoid)canbeclinicallyindistinguishablefrom IgE-mediated
reactionsbecausethefinalcommonpathwayfortheirreactionismastcelldegranulation.
Maculopapularexanthemasarethemostcommoncutaneousmanifestationofdrugallergy.
ThesereactionsaremediatedbyTcellsandtypicallydelayedinonset,firstoccurringbetween2and
14daysofexposuretoculpritmedications.Itcanoccursoonerwithsubsequentexposures.Lesions
typicallybeginonthetrunk,especiallyindependentareas,andspreadtotheextremities.
Rarely, these rashes canprogress toa more seriousdrug reactioninvolving blistering ofthe skin
and/orend-organinvolvement.
DRESS(DrugReactionwithEosinophiliaandSystemicSymptoms)isaseriouslife-threateningADR,
https://t.me/med1917

often presenting as rash and fever with systemic involvement, and can manifest as hepatitis,
eosinophilia,pneumonitis,lymphadenopathy,andnephritis.
Symptoms tend to present 2–6 weeks after introduction of medication and resolve few weeks to
monthsafterstoppingtheoffendingagent.CertainviralinfectionssuchasEpstein–Barrvirus,human
herpesvirus (HHV)-6, HHV-7, and cytomegalovirus are associated with increased risk of
complications.
Firstdescribedwithantiepileptic (carbamazepine)agentsbuthasalsobeenreportedtooccurwith
allopurinol,NSAIDs,someantibiotics,andβ-blockers.
Erythema multiforme (EM), SJS, and TEN are all serious drug reactions primarily involving the
skin.
EMischaracterizedmosttypicallybytargetlesions.SJSandTENmanifestwithvaryingdegreesof
sloughingoftheskinandmucousmembranes(<10%inSJSand>30%inTEN).Riskfactorsbeing
HIV,hematologicalmalignancy,systemiclupuserythematosus,andbonemarrowtransplant.
Readministrationorfutureskintestingwiththeoffendingdrugisabsolutelycontraindicated.
PreventionandTreatment
Acute drug reactions such as anaphylaxis should be treated promptly and discontinuation of the
suspecteddrugisthemostimportantinitialapproachinmanaginganallergicdrugreaction.
HLAtesting may be indicated insusceptible populations for prevention of a severe ADRfor some
drugssuchasabacavirandcarbamazepine.
Futureuseofthedruginquestionshouldalwaysbeavoidedunlessthereisnotherapeuticalternative
available.
Ifuseofthedrugmustbeconsidered,acarefulhistoryofthereactionishelpfulindefiningthepotential
risk. Patients may lose their sensitivitytoa drug over time, and determining the date of reactionis
useful. Symptoms that occur with the start ofa drugcourse are more likelyto be IgE-mediated than
symptomsthatdevelopseveraldaysafterthecompletionofacourse.
The types of symptoms are also important. Toxic reactions (e.g., nausea secondary to macrolide
antibiotics or codeine) are notimmunologic reactions and do not necessarilypredictproblemswith
othermembersintheirrespectiveclass.
Referral
IfnoalternativedrugisavailableandthepatienthasahistoryofanIgE-mediatedreaction,thepatient
shouldbereferredtoanallergistforfurtherevaluation.
Theallergistmayperformoneofseveralproceduresifindicateddependingonthemedication,typeof
reaction,andavailabilityoftestingreagents.
SkintestingmaybeperformedtoassessforthepresenceofIgEtothemedication.
Althoughskintestingmay beperformedtonearlyanymedication,sensitivityandspecificity ofthe
skintestresultshavebeenbestestablishedwithpenicillin.
Resultsoftestingtodrugsotherthanpenicillinmustbeinterpretedwithintheclinicalcontextofthe
case.
Gradeddose challenge assesses howthepatient tolerates progressivelylargerdoses ofmedication
(e.g.,1/1000,1/10,andfulldosegiven20minutesapart).
Drug desensitization is defined as induction of temporary state of clinical unresponsiveness or
tolerancetoasuspecteddrug.ItisperformedwhenthepatienthasanidentifiedIgE-mediatedreaction
butstillrequiresthemedication.
Thedrugmustbetakendailyataspecifieddosetomaintainthe“desensitizedstate.”
https://t.me/med1917

Ifadoseofthedrugismissedfollowingadesensitizationprocedure,thenthepatientwilloftenneed
toundergoa repeatdesensitizationas the desensitizationstatewill wanebased onhalf-lifeofthe
drug.
Successful desensitization or graded challenge does not preclude the development of a non–IgE-
mediatedordelayedreaction(e.g.,rash).
Anaphylaxis
GENERALPRINCIPLES
Definition
Anaphylaxisisarapidlydeveloping,life-threateningsystemicreactionmediatedbythereleaseofmast
cellandbasophil-derivedmediatorsintothecirculation.Thepeakseverityisseenusuallywithin5–30
minutes.
Classification
Immunologicanaphylaxis:IgEmediated(type1hypersensitivity)orIgGmediated(rare)
Nonimmunologicanaphylaxis.Previouslyknownaspseudoallergicoranaphylactoidreactions
Epidemiology
Incidenceofanaphylaxisisapproximately50–2000episodesper100,000person-years.Fatalityis
estimatedat0.7%–2%percaseofanaphylaxis.IntheUS,thelifetimeprevalenceofanaphylaxisis
reportedtobe1.6%.
9
Etiology
Immunologiccauses
Foods,especiallypeanuts,treenuts,shellfish,finnedfish,milk,andeggs
Insectstings(bees,wasps,andfireants)
Medications
Latexrubber
Bloodproducts
Nonimmunologiccauses
Radiocontrastmedia
Medications(i.e.,NSAIDs,opiates,vancomycin,musclerelaxants,rarelyACEinhibitors,andsulfating
agents)
Hemodialysis
Physicalfactors(coldtemperatureorexercise)
Idiopathic
Pathophysiology
IMMUNOLOGIC
Anaphylaxis is due to sensitization to an antigen and formation of specific IgE to that antigen. On
https://t.me/med1917

reexposure, the IgE onmast cells and basophils binds the antigenand cross-links the IgE receptor,
whichcausesactivationofthecellswithsubsequentsystemicreleaseofpreformedmediators,suchas
histamine.
The release of mediators ultimately causes capillary leakage, cellular edema, and smooth muscle
contractionsresultingintheconstellationofphysicalsymptoms.
NONIMMUNOLOGIC
Non–IgE-mediatedanaphylaxisisalsomediatedbydirectdegranulationofmastcellsandbasophilsinthe
absenceofimmunoglobulins.
RiskFactors
Persistentasthma:increasedriskoffatalanaphylaxisifasthmaisuncontrolled.
Cardiovasculardisease:increasedriskfordeathinolderage.
Elevated baseline tryptase indicates possible mast cell disorder. Individuals with mastocytosis, a
diseasecharacterizedbya proliferationofmastcells,are athigher riskforsevereanaphylaxis from
bothIgE-andnon–IgE-mediatedcauses.
Previoussensitizationandformationofantigen-specificIgEwithhistoryofanaphylaxis.
Concomitantusedrugs:beta-adrenergicblockers,ACEinhibitors,NSAIDs,alcohol,etc.
Cofactorssuchasexercise,fever,acuteinfection,premenstrualstatus,andemotional.
Sensitivitytoseafoodoriodinedoesnotpredisposetoradiocontrastmediareactions.
Prevention
For all types of anaphylaxis, recognition of potential triggers and avoidance are the best
prevention.
Self-injectableepinephrineandpatienteducationforallpatientswithahistoryofanaphylaxis.
Radiocontrastsensitivityreactions:
Premedicationbeforeprocedureincludegivingprednisone50mgPOgiven13,7,and1hourbefore
procedureanddiphenhydramine50mgPOgiven1hourbeforeprocedure.
Premedicationisnot100%effective,andappropriateprecautionsforhandlingareactionshould
betaken.
Red man syndrome from vancomycin: symptoms can usually be prevented by slowing the rate of
infusionandpremedicatingwithdiphenhydramine(50mgPO)30minutesbeforestartoftheinfusionas
thisisanon–IgE-mediateddrugreaction.
DIAGNOSIS
Diagnosisisbasedprimarilyonhistoryandphysicalexaminationandthedocumentationofthepresence
ofaspecificIgEtothesuspectedallergen(ifthetriggerisIgEmediated).Confirmationofanaphylaxis
can,insomecases,beprovidedbythelaboratoryfindingofanelevatedserumtryptaselevel.However,
theabsenceofanelevatedtryptaseleveldoesnotexcludeanaphylaxis,particularlyiffoodisthe
suspectedcause.
ClinicalPresentation
Theclinicalmanifestationsofallergicandnonimmunologicanaphylaxisarethesame.
Manifestationsincludepruritus,flushing,urticaria, angioedema,respiratorydistress(duetolaryngeal
https://t.me/med1917

edema,laryngospasm,orbronchospasm),hypotension,uterinecramping,abdominalcramping,emesis,
anddiarrhea.
Mostseriousreactionsoccurwithinminutesafterexposuretotheantigen,butinsomecircumstances,
the reaction may be delayed for hours. An example is the galactose-α-1,3-galactose allergy that is
thoughttobe triggered bytick bites and isa cause ofdelayedanaphylaxis(3–6 hours) toredmeats
includingbeef,pork,andlamb.
Some patients experience a biphasic reaction characterized by a recurrence of symptoms after
resolutionofinitialanaphylacticepisode.Timerangeisvariedandtypicallyoccurs1–8hours.
A few patientshaveaprotractedcoursethatrequires severalhourstodaysofcontinuoussupportive
treatment.
HISTORY
Athoroughhistoryistakentohelpidentifythepotentialtrigger,suchasnewfoods,medications,orother
commonlyknownallergens.Alsodocumentingthetimeofonsetofsymptoms—thatis,minutestohoursor
daysafterasuspectedexposure—canhelptoclassifythetypeofanaphylaxis.
PHYSICALEXAMINATION
Payspecialattentiontovitalsigns:Bloodpressure,respiratoryrate,andoxygensaturation.
Airwayandpulmonary: Assessforanyevidenceoflaryngealedemaor angioedema.Auscultatelung
fieldstolistenforevidenceofwheezing.Continuetoassessforneedtoprotecttheairway.
Performafocusedcardiovascularexamination.
Skin:Urticariaorerythema.
DiagnosticCriteria

DifferentialDiagnosis
AnaphylaxisduetopreformedIgEandre-exposure:Medications,insectsting,andfoodsarethemost
commoncausesofanaphylaxis.
Exercise-inducedanaphylaxis:anaphylaxisoccursexclusivelyinassociationwithphysical exertion
andothercofactors.Triggersincludefood(wheat,celery,nuts,seafood)andNSAIDs.Treatmentwould
betoavoidexerciseimmediatelyaftereatingcausativefoods.
Causesofnon–IgE-mediatedanaphylaxis
Radiocontrast sensitivity reactions are thought to be from direct degranulation of mast cells in
susceptiblepatientsbecauseofosmoticshifts.
Redman’ssyndromefromvancomycinconsistsofpruritusandflushingofthefaceandneck.
Mastocytosis.
Ingestant-relatedreactionscanmimicanaphylaxis.Thisis usuallyduetosulfitesorthepresence
ofahistamine-likesubstanceinspoiledfish(scombroidosis).
Flushing syndromes include flushingdueto red man syndrome, carcinoid, vasointestinal peptide
(andothervasoactiveintestinalpeptide–secretingtumors),postmenopausalsymptoms,rosacea,use
ofniacin,andalcoholuse.
Otherformsofshocksuchashypoglycemic,cardiogenic,septic,andhemorrhagic.
Vasovagal syncope can be distinguishedfrom anaphylaxis bythepresence ofbradycardia; however,
bradycardiacanoccurinanaphylaxisbecauseoftheBezold–Jarischreflex.
Respiratorydiseasessuchasacutelaryngotracheitisandforeignbodyobstructionintrachea.
Miscellaneous syndromes such as hereditary angioedema (HAE; C1 esterase inhibitor [C1 INH]
deficiencysyndrome),pheochromocytoma,neurologic(seizure,stroke),andcapillaryleaksyndrome.
Neuropsychiatriccausessuchaspanicattacksorvocalcorddysfunction.
Idiopathic.
DiagnosticTesting
Epicutaneousskintestingandserum-specificIgEtestingwhenavailabletoidentifytriggerallergens.
Serumtryptasepeaksat1houraftersymptomsbeginandmaybepresentforupto4hours.
TREATMENT
Earlyrecognitionofsignsandsymptomsofanaphylaxisisacriticalfirststepintreatment.
Epinephrineisthemedicationofchoicefortreatmentofanaphylaxis.
Maintainrecumbentpositionwhileassessingandstartingtherapy.
Airway management is a priority. Supplemental 100% oxygen therapy should be administered.
Endotrachealintubationmaybenecessary.Iflaryngealedemaisnotrapidlyresponsivetoepinephrine,
cricothyroidotomyortracheotomymayberequired.
VolumeexpansionwithIVfluidsmaybenecessary.
Medications
https://t.me/med1917

Epinephrineshouldbeadministeredimmediately.Therearenoabsolutecontraindicationsfortreatment
withepinephrineinanaphylaxis.
Adult: 0.3–0.5 mg(0.3–0.5 mL ofa 1:1000 solution)IM in the lateral thigh, repeated at 10- to 15minuteintervalsifnecessary.
Child:1:1000dilutionat0.01mg/kgor0.1–0.3mLadministeredIMinthelateralthigh,repeatedat10to15-minuteintervalsifnecessary.
0.5mLof1:1000solutionsublinguallyincasesofmajorairwaycompromiseorhypotension.
3–5mLof1:10,000solutionviacentralline.
3–5mLof1:10,000solutiondilutedwith10mLofnormalsalineviaendotrachealtube.
For protracted symptoms that require multiple doses ofepinephrine,anIV epinephrinedrip may be
useful;theinfusionistitratedtomaintainadequateBP.
Glucagoncouldreverserefractorybronchospasmandhypotensioninpatientswhoaretakingβadrenergicantagonists.Recommendeddosageis1–5mgintravenouslybolusslowlyover5minutes
followedbyaninfusionat5–15µg/mintitratedtoclinicalresponse.Monitorforsideeffectssuchas
nauseaandvomiting.
Inhaledβ-adrenergicagonistsshouldbeusedtotreatresistantbronchospasm.
Glucocorticoidshavenosignificantimmediateeffectandmaynotpreventbiphasicreactions.
Antihistaminesrelieveskinsymptomsbuthavenoimmediateeffectonthereaction.Theymayshortenthe
durationofthereaction.
Adult:Diphenhydramine25–50mgIMorIV,cetirizine10mgoralorIV
Child:Diphenhydramine12.5–25.0mgIMorIV,cetirizine5–10mgoralorIV
Referral
Referralstoanallergistforfurtherevaluationshouldbeofferedtoallpatientswithahistoryof
anaphylaxis.Moreimportantly,patientswithHymenopterasensitivityshouldbeevaluatedtodetermine
eligibilityforvenomimmunotherapy.
Eosinophilia
GENERALPRINCIPLES
Eosinophilsaregranulocytesthatdevelopedfrombonemarrowpluripotentprogenitorcells.
Eosinophil maturationis promotedbyinterleukins (IL-5, IL-3), andgranulocyte-macrophagecolonystimulatingfactor.
Eosinophils arenormallyseeninperipheral tissuesuchasmucosal tissuesinthegastrointestinaland
respiratorytracts.Theyarerecruitedtositesofinflammation.
Eosinophilscanbeinvolvedinavarietyofinfectious,allergic,neoplastic,andidiopathicdiseases.
Definition
Avalue>500eosinophils/μLisdefinedashavingeosinophilia.
The extent of eosinophilia can be categorized as mild (500–1500 cells/μL), moderate (1500–5000
cells/μL),orsevere(>5000cells/μL).
Thedegreeofeosinophiliaisnotareliablepredictorofeosinophil-mediatedorgandamage.
Classification
https://t.me/med1917

Peripheraleosinophiliacanbedividedintoprimary,secondary,oridiopathic.
Primary eosinophilia is seenwith hematologic disorders where there maybe a clonal expansion of
eosinophils (chronic eosinophilic leukemia) or a clonal expansion of cells that stimulate eosinophil
production(chronicmyeloidorlymphocyticdisorders).
Secondaryeosinophiliaisalsocalledreactiveeosinophilia.Itisapolyclonalexpansionofeosinophils
due to overproduction of IL-5. There are numerous causes such as parasites, allergic diseases,
autoimmunedisorders,toxins,medications,andendocrinedisorderssuchasAddisondisease.
Idiopathiceosinophiliaisconsideredwhenprimaryandsecondarycausesareexcluded.
HYPEREOSINOPHILICSYNDROME
Aproliferativedisorderofeosinophilscharacterizedbysustainedeosinophilia>1500cells/μLfor≥1
monthdocumentedontwooccasionswitheosinophil-mediateddamagetoorganssuchastheheart,
gastrointestinaltract,kidneys,brain,andlung.Allothercausesofeosinophiliashouldbeexcludedto
makethediagnosis.
10
Hypereosinophilicsyndrome(HES)occurspredominantlyinmenbetweentheagesof20and50years
andpresentswithinsidiousonsetoffatigue,cough,anddyspnea.
Approximately 10%–15% HES patients have myeloproliferative disorders. Myeloproliferative
variantsofHESare characterizedbyconstitutive expressionofFIP1L1/PDGFRAfusionproteinand
elevatedserumvitaminB12levels.
Lymphocytic-variantHES(L-HES)accounts for 17%–26%HESpatients.Unusual IL-5–producing T
cellsarefoundinL-HES.
Cardiac disease is a major cause ofmorbidity and mortalityinpatients withHES.At presentation,
patientstypicallyareinthelatethromboticandfibroticstagesofeosinophil-mediatedcardiacdamage
with signs of a restrictive cardiomyopathy and mitral regurgitation. An echocardiogram may detect
intracardiac thrombi, endomyocardial fibrosis, or thickening of the posterior mitral valve leaflet.
Neurologicmanifestationsrangefromperipheralneuropathytostrokeorencephalopathy.Bonemarrow
examinationrevealsincreasedeosinophilprecursors.
AcuteeosinophilicleukemiaisararemyeloproliferativedisorderthatisdistinguishedfromHESby
severalfactors:anincreasednumberofimmatureeosinophilsinthebloodand/ormarrow,>10%blast
formsinthemarrow,andsymptomsandsignscompatiblewithanacuteleukemia.Treatmentissimilar
tootherleukemias.
Lymphoma.EosinophiliacanpresentinanyT-orB-celllymphoma.Asmanyas5%ofpatientswith
non-Hodgkin lymphoma and up to 15% of patients withHodgkinlymphoma havemodestperipheral
bloodeosinophilia.EosinophiliainHodgkinlymphomahasbeencorrelatedwithIL-5messengerRNA
expressionbyReed–Sternbergcells.
Atheroembolic disease. Cholesterol embolization can lead to eosinophilia, eosinophiluria, renal
dysfunction,livedoreticularis,purpletoes,andincreasederythrocytesedimentationrate(ESR).
Immunodeficiency. Hyper-IgE syndrome, autoimmune lymphoproliferative syndrome, and Omenn
syndromecanpresentwithrecurrentinfections,dermatitis,andeosinophilia.
Epidemiology
Inindustrializednations,peripheralbloodeosinophiliaismostoftenduetoatopicdisease,whereas
helminthicinfectionsarethemostcommoncauseofeosinophiliaintherestoftheworld.

ClinicalPresentation
HISTORY
A history is important in narrowing the differential diagnosis of eosinophilia. It is important to
determineifthe patienthas symptoms ofatopic disease (rhinitis, wheezing, rash) or cancer (weight
loss, fatigue,fever,night sweats) andtoevaluatefor otherspecific organ involvementsuch as lung,
heart,ornerves.Prioreosinophilcountcanhelpdeterminethedurationandmagnitudeofeosinophilia.
A completemedication list, including over-the-counter supplements, and a full travel, occupational,
anddietaryhistoryshouldbeobtained.
Anypetcontactshouldbeascertainedforpossibleexposuretotoxocariasis.
PHYSICALEXAMINATION
Physicalexaminationshouldbeguidedbythehistory,withaspecialfocusontheskin,upperandlower
respiratorytracts,andcardiovascularandneurologicsystems.
LABORATORIES
Initial laboratory evaluations generally include complete blood count (CBC) with differential and
eosinophil count, liver function tests, serum chemistries and creatinine, serum vitamin B12 level,
troponin,markersofinflammation(e.g.,ESRand/orC-reactiveprotein[CRP]),andurinalysis.Further
diagnostic studies are based on clinical presentations and initial findings. Mild eosinophilia
associatedwithsymptomsofrhinitisorasthmaisindicativeofunderlyingatopicdisease,whichcan
beconfirmedbyskintesting.
